AI stocks will have a big effect on how Russell is rebuilt

The frantic rally in stocks related to artificial intelligence (AI) over the past year is expected to have a significant impact on the final form of the benchmark indexes, which investors are preparing for on Friday. 

The FTSE Russell’s multi-step process for the annual refresh of its indexes will be completed by the Russell Reconstitution, an event that typically results in one of the busiest trading days of the year. It will become official after the closing bell on Friday. This once-a-year change prompts reserve directors to change their portfolios to mirror the new weightings and parts. 

A variety of Russell indexes, including the Russell 1000 index of large-cap stocks, are included in this update. RUI) and the small-cap Russell 2000 index. The Russell 3000, also known as RUT) RUA) file. Style indices like the Russell 1000 growth are another option. Russell 2000 value and RLG). RUJ) files. 

This year, Russell’s growth and value indexes are expected to be significantly impacted by the furious rally in AI-related stocks like Nvidia (NVDA.O) and Super Micro Computer (SMCI.O) since the reconstitution last year. Indeed, even with a new slide, Nvidia shares as of Monday have mobilized around 180% from a year prior, while Very Miniature has acquired than 230%. 

Microsoft (MSFT.O) has increased by more than 31%, while Meta Platforms (META.O) has increased by nearly 75%. side ETFs: Brazil reserves are “toward the start of the end” The outperformance in development implies there will be less than 400 stocks in the Russell 1000 development record, as per Jefferies value planner Steven DeSanctis in New York, who gauges the main five names will represent more than 44% of the weighting. 

DeSanctis stated, “All the top names keep getting a chunkier and chunkier proportion.” DeSanctis anticipates a 4.6% decrease in the weighting of technology and a 3.4% increase in health care in the Russell 2000 growth. 

According to Bryant VanCronkhite, senior portfolio manager at Allspring Global Investments in Menomonee Falls, Wisconsin, the technology and communication services sector is expected to make up approximately two-thirds of the Russell 1000 growth index. In the mean time, around 45 stocks are leaving the development record, decreasing the file to a little more than 390 names, contrasted with approximately 870 in the partner esteem record, VanCronkhite said. 

“When you have fewer tools in the toolbox, it becomes much more difficult to beat benchmarks,” VanCronkhite stated. “On the off chance that you have fewer names, you might have less choices to develop the best portfolio.” FTSE Russell only reconstitutes once a year, with the exception of adding initial public offerings on a quarterly basis, unlike some index providers, which choose to constantly refresh their indexes to maintain a fixed number of components. 

Since the reconstitution is very much transmitted consistently, it likewise encourages extra interest for trading stocks as certain financial backers might consider the extra liquidity to be a valuable chance to make the most of any cost separations that might result. According to FTSE Russell, U.S. stocks traded for $72.7 billion and $61.7 billion in the final moments of Friday trading on the New York Stock Exchange and Nasdaq exchanges, respectively, at the reconstitution in June 2023. 

Because of the fixation in the uber cap development stocks, for example, Nvidia this year, the average huge cap development director is underweight by the main ten benchmark stocks by 16.7%, UBS senior U.S. value specialist Patrick Palfrey assessed in a report toward the end of last month. 

Palfrey expects the main 10 organization loads in the Russell 1000 development record to increase from 56.1% to 61.3% after the revival. According to the UBS analysts’ report to clients, “In theory, the increase in concentration from the rebalance would create buying pressure in these stocks, in practice, the impact should be mitigated by portfolio diversification rules,” noting that this should increase growth managers’ tracking error. 

Assets were benchmarked to the Russell U.S. indexes for approximately $10.5 trillion in December 2023, and $15.9 trillion worldwide. Although Russell has begun offering indexes that either exclude or cap the weight of the largest stocks by market cap, the indexes’ methodology is currently unaffected by market concentration. 

“We are here to provide indexes that reflect the market. Catherine Yoshimoto, Director of Product Management for the Russell US Indexes at FTSE Russell, stated, “That’s what we’re hearing consistently from our clients that they want.” “Furthermore, for the individuals who have different requirements, we are sorting out arrangements that could work for them, similar to the covered files or rejection records or various divisions of the market.”
